Originally Posted by Couch-Potato: CINCINNATI — DeAndre Hopkins might've had productive visits in Nashville and Foxboro, but the star wide receiver is still hoping to land with a legitimate Super Bowl contender according to Sports Illustrated's Albert Breer.
"He's still holding out hope that he's going to play for a contender, like a true contender like a Buffalo or Kansas City," Breer said on NBC Sports Boston.
The NFL insider believes Hopkins could land in Kansas City if the Chiefs are able to sign Chris Jones to a long-term extension and lower the cap hit of their star defensive tackle.
Last week, free-agent wide receiver DeAndre Hopkins took visits with both the Tennessee Titans and New England Patriots.
According to ESPN NFL insider Dianna Russini, both of these organizations have issued offers to D-Hop and he's weighing them as his final two options.
According to DraftKings odds from earlier this week, the Patriots are overwhelming favorites to land D-Hop at +100. The Bills have the next best odds at +350, followed by the Titans at +400 and the Lions at +500. [Reply]
